Abstract
In the online facility assignment on a line (OFAL) with a set of servers and a capacity , each server with a capacity is placed on a line and a request arrives on a line one-by-one. The task of an online algorithm is to irrevocably assign a current request to one of the servers with vacancies before the next request arrives. An algorithm can assign up to requests to each server . In this paper, we show that the competitive ratio of the permutation algorithm is at least for OFAL where the servers are evenly placed on a line. This disproves the result that the permutation algorithm is -competitive by Ahmed et al..
